Story: A True Classic

When it comes to summer squash, Black Beauty is the one that shows up early, stays late, and plays well in everything. First introduced in the 1920s and still the most widely grown variety today, this heirloom zucchini has tender, glossy skin and a creamy white interior that’s mild, flavorful, and endlessly adaptable.

Steam it, sauté it, spiralize it, bake it into bread, or grate it into a tangy relish—it’s the kind of ingredient that slips seamlessly into sweet or savory, breakfast or dinner. A true garden workhorse with All-America flavor credentials (hello, 1957 winner), Black Beauty is summer at its most generous.
